Description

The boat is a traditional turkish motorsailer, 23 meters, has 5 cabins for guests. Each cabin has double bed, and own private shower/toilette, air conditioned. The boat has a capacity of 12 guests during the weekly cruise, but has a capacity of 38 guests during the daily excursions. Canoa, set snorkeling, paddle sup, rods fishing are available for free. EXTRA SERVICES (CHARGEABLE): Air conditioning, Scuba diving courses with WASE, PADI, and CMAS certifications, water skiing lessons. Sunset aperitif. Ladies only: Relaxing 30-minute sunset massages. The on-board cuisine offers many specialities of traditional Sicilian and Italian gastronomy, based on fresh fish, accompanied by excellent local wines. The crew, who speak English and French, will take care of your holidays with professionalism and friendliness.

How long does a rental last?
The basic daily rental is structured as either a quarter-, half-, or full-day. A quarter-day is two hours, a half-day is four hours, and a full-day is eight hours. You can also discuss a custom trip with the boat by contacting the owner through Sailo. Most term charters (weekly rentals) are from Saturday to Saturday. Keep in mind that the boat generally needs to be back at the dock by Friday evening, and you will need to be off the boat on Saturday morning so they can prepare the boat for the next guests.
